Victrola XVIII Rear Motor Access Door Needed- I have acquired a Victrola
XVIII that is missing the rear door behind the
motor. I also need the needle holder. This part can also come from a
Victrola XVII, as they are both the same. The rear
door however is unique to the XVIII because of the moulding on the door.
The dimensions of the opening is 18” wide
and 11 5/8'” high. Any help would be greatly appreciated. Bill Feiner
